Mark Robert Mattingly Obituary

PRINCETON – Mark Mattingly was born February 23, 1962, of Deer Grove, IL, son of Robert and Bonnie (Hardy) Mattingly. He passed away August 2, 2023 at St. Anthony Hospital in Rockford.


He grew up on his parents’ farm, fishing and trapping by the Green River. He hunted with his dad and when he was 16 years old, he got his first deer, and every year thereafter, both of them looked forward to the quiet time in the woods hunting together.


Mark graduated from Walnut High School in 1980 and soon became a talented drywaller, carpenter, and able to fix anything mechanical if he set his mind to it. After returning from a time living in Colorado, he was employed at Walnut Custom Homes, in Walnut, for over 37 years before becoming ill.


He had two children, Robert (Deanna) Mattingly, of Princeton, and Elysia (Jeff) Vance, of West Salem, WI.


Later in life he met Emily (Suzanne) Williams and helped raise four bonus sons, Tyler, Jarod, Jacob, and Peyton, all of Princeton. He has seven grandchildren, Olivia, Dominick, Wesley, Ana, Sophia, Hayden, Tessa, and two more on the way.


Survivors include his parents, Bonnie and Robert, his sister, Lori (Robert) Fordham, of Sterling; niece, Jami (John) Fritz, of Sterling; and nephew, Josh Eggleston, of Eldridge, IA.


Cremation rites will be accorded. A gathering of family and friends will be held from 10:00am-12:00pm on Tuesday, August 8, 2023 at Garland Funeral Home in Walnut. Memorial service will follow at 12:00pm. Private interment will be at Walnut Cemetery.
